<anchor-external xmlns="urn:x-suika-fam-cx:markup:suikawiki:0:9:" a0:resScheme="URI" xmlns:a0="urn:x-suika-fam-cx:markup:suikawiki:0:9:" a0:resParameter="http://spider.seds.org/os2/webextag.html">http://spider.seds.org/os2/webextag.html</anchor-external></figcaption><blockquote><p>internal attribute for the &lt;img&gt; tag</p><p>used to show some internal mini images (used e.g. in WebEx's internal webmap.html page), in place of the &quot;src&quot; attribute. Please notify me in case you miss one !</p><p>ibmlogo</p><p>red_bullet</p><p>left_arrow</p><p>internal-gopher-menu</p><p>Usage:</p><p>&lt;img align=middle internal=ibmlogo&gt;</p><p>&lt;img align=middle internal=red_bullet&gt;</p><p>&lt;img align=middle internal=left_arrow&gt;</p><p>&lt;img align=middle internal=internal-gopher-menu&gt;</p><p>at the place in the html file where you want to have the symbol</p></blockquote></figure></body></html>
